Embedded Engineering Manager
Listed on 2025-12-25
-
Engineering
Embedded Software Engineer, Systems Engineer
Join to apply for the Embedded Engineering Manager role at Raise Workforce
This role offers a competitive base pay range and relocation assistance as detailed below.
Base Pay Range$/yr - $/yr
Benefits- Location:
Logan, UT - Full‑time, permanent position plus PTO
- Health, dental, vision benefits available
- Life insurance, long term disability, 401k plan
- Relocation assistance available
Summary
The Embedded Engineering Manager directs and guides the activities of research and technical implementation functions responsible for designing, developing, modifying, and evaluating electronic parts, components or integrated circuitry for electronic equipment, embedded firmware for hardware control, and software application programs for products. The role evaluates final results of research and development projects, prepares and presents reports outlining outcomes, and makes recommendations for actions necessary to achieve desired results.
The manager supervises electrical hardware and software design personnel.
- Analyze design proposals, product requirements, and specifications to determine feasibility of hardware and firmware/application designs in conjunction with development time, budget, and unit cost.
- Research, analyze, and recommend the most current product system architecture that maps to product requirements, including platforms for electronic hardware and firmware/software applications.
- Specify and maintain development platforms for both hardware and software systems.
- Oversee planning, development, and documentation activities associated with electrical and electromechanical components and subsystems, embedded firmware, and software applications.
- Guide and contribute to the design and execution of test protocols and experiments to verify and validate designs, ensuring results are documented appropriately in reports.
- Manage interfaces between design resources for electrical hardware, software, and other engineering staff to evaluate interfaces and resolve engineering design and test problems as needed.
- Ensure that firmware/software development activities follow software life cycle processes that meet applicable regulatory requirements and coding standards, and are well documented for future reference and maintenance.
- Document development activities consistent with formal quality systems, including definition of input requirements, project planning, design output, review, verification, validation, change control, and risk management.
- Coordinate and manage activities with internal and external project stakeholders throughout the design and development process, including transition to production.
- Communicate project status, major issues, mitigations, and other information to stakeholders and management.
- Establish expectations and goals for direct employees and motivate them to achieve company objectives and employee development.
- Analyze and resolve employee-related issues and problems that may arise in the department and assist employees to solve problems and implement solutions.
- Assist with related special projects as required.
- Bachelor’s Degree or higher in Electrical Engineering, Computer Science, Software Engineering, or a related field from a four‑year college or university and at least seven (7) years' experience. A minimum of two (2) years' experience in technical oversight or management roles is required.
- Analog and digital circuit design, schematic capture, layout, board bring‑up and debugging, component library maintenance.
- Design for EMC compliance per IEC 61326‑1 or similar, including test approach and strategies.
- Design for electrical safety compliance per IEC 61010‑1 or similar.
- Embedded system development with a variety of processing platforms (e.g., Microchip, NXP, TI, STM, ARM), with experience in C/C++ programming.
- Hardware and software architecture recommendations (system level design).
- Embedded Linux development, from integration of BSPs and kernel customization to full embedded application including UI.
- Code reviews and development of test protocols for software verification to ensure adherence to coding standards, maintainability, and reliability.
- Working within…
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).